Awareness campaign would be conducted with the objective of bringing mass public awareness from September 1, 2020 to August 31, 2021 

 

In a bid to make people aware about their legal rights and laws, Chhattisgarh State Legal Services Authority (CGSLSA) is going to launch legal awareness campaign titled ‘Jan Chetna’ on different laws across the state from September 1. Speaking to The Hitavada, Member Secretary of the CGSLSA Siddharth Aggarwal said that on the instructions of Chief Justice of High Court of Chhattisgarh and Patron-in-Chief of the CGSLSA P R Ramchandra Menon and Executive Chairman of the CGSLSA Justice Prashant Kumar Mishra, the awareness campaign would be conducted with the objective of bringing mass public awareness from September 1 to August 31, 2021. Each District Legal Services Authority (DLSA) has been allotted a separate subject under the special campaign.

 

The CGSLSA has directed all DLSAs of the state to prepare brief information about the law in the simple language of Hindi in the form of pamphlets. At least two or more of its judges can be identified as spokespersons under the guidance of the district judge, who is able to make videos in the e-platform and make it available to the audience. Judges identified under this campaign will be provided with the subjects, who can record videos in the allotted subject at Sampark Kranti Sahayata Kendra of the DLSA or any other suitable place, said Aggarwal. The videos in the above-allotted subject will be uploaded on the DLSA’s website. Apart from this, the recorded videos will be displayed on the Facebook page of the DLSA as well as broadcasted by the DLSA on its YouTube channel among the common people. The video recorded in the allotted subject will be sent to the Jila Panchayat with the request that it be digitally communicated to the common public in coordination with their subordinate appointed Sarpanch, Secretary, Employment Assistant, Mitaneen and other employees and will be disseminated amongst the community.

 

The recorded video will be transmitted to the District Education Officer with the request that he or she can disseminate the same through online education among the students in schools and colleges. The videos will be made available to the DLSA for publicity and broadcast among the people by running on available LED TV. Apart from this, videos all districts will be uploaded in separate folders by creating a YouTube channel at the SLSA level. Dissemination will also be done through “Nyay Mobile App” and other means. Similarly, videos will be promoted and broadcast on the Facebook page of the CGSLSA. Statistics regarding the number of views by people on the YouTube channel and Facebook page of the CGSLSA will be obtained from commuter programme.

 

The DLSA has been directed to prepare brief information about the laws on PPT on a maximum of two or three pages in respect of the allotted subject. The prepared PPT will be disseminated and broadcasted. The common people will be made aware about domestic violence act, Hamar Angna scheme, law related to ragging, environmental laws, electronic evidence in light of latest judgement of Supreme Court under Section 65B Evidence Act Maintenance Right of Parents including Senior Citizen Act 2007, custodial rights of arrest person including pre arrest, arrest and post arrest scheme of NLSA, law of probation and parole, Right to Privacy in India, crime against women, cyber crimes, law relating to divorce under Hindu, Muslim, Christian and Parsi law, ban on Gutka in light of provision of Food and Safety Standard Act 2006, Chhattisgarh Excise Act and other laws, the Member Secretary added.
